I have eaten at most likely all of the Mr. Burger locations in Grand Rapids and I always get good hot high-quality food at a decent price, however, there is another restaurant owned by the same people called 'The Filling Station' which is located on Alpine Ave, and it's worth the drive.
The thing that is different about the Filling Station is that it has Mexican Food on its menu along with the usual Mr. Burger type fare. People seem to love their burgers and they are really good and remind folks of the former Mr. Fables Famous Beefburgers.
I had theThree Taco Special for lunch one day and it was tremendous! It came with three tacos filled with meat the cheese and I mean they were filled. Nothing like Taco Bell where you get a centimeter of meat and even less cheese, there Tacos's were worth the money I spent. I have also enjoyed the Grilled Cheese, and the Cheese Burger also.
So if you ever get hungry for a great burger or some Mexican food head north on Alpine, past the bowling alley and keep going until you see the sign that reads "The Filling Station", it's worth it!

G&L Chili Dogs of Holland
Well I have driven past this place a hundred times, never stopped in because I don't like hot dogs, but when I saw their menu online they had plenty of other things to eat that I do enjoy. So one fine afternoon, after taking my daughter to a doctors appointment, we stopped in for a light snack, and ended up eating an early dinner.
I was expecting your average run of the mill fast food place where you order at the counter, pay, and then wait for your food. Not at G&L Greek Chili Dogs, we were ushered to a booth, the waitress took our drink orders, and gave us ample time to decide what we wanted to eat.
They of course have their proprietary hot dogs, and chili dogs, but they have aprox. forty different items on their menu, so everyone can find something they like to eat even if they are like me, and hate hot dogs. Let me just say that yes the hot dogs are skinny little dogs compared to other places, but the reason is that they are all meat, and NO fillers like the other guys dogs. So if you've never tried one of G&L's chili dogs, go try one today!
I had the grilled cheese w/ fries, and my daughter has the chicken strips meal. She could not stop raving about how good the strips were compared to all the fast food chain restaurants she has been too. The grilled cheese was on thick texas toast, buttered and grilled to perfection. On the next two trips I enjoyed the double cheese burger w. just ketchup on it. The burgers are made from high quality fresh ground beef, and served hot and fresh every time.
The waitresses are friendly and helpful, the cook who runs the place likes to talk to the customers, very friendly. The place in clean, and a nice place to eat at a good price. Support local West Michigan based businesses! Try G&L today, they have three restaurants in Muskegon, and one in Holland on Lakewood Blvd.!
